Legislation Watch

Bill Watch
CHN categorizes bills in the California legislature that bear watching because of the way they might affect homeschooling.

California's Standards, Curriculum, and Assessment
This may come in handy if you must write out what your child will be learning. Good for pulling out "educationalese" if you really must. Many files in Adobe Acrobat.

Correspondence/Documents
Written materials from the DOE that offer guidance to public and private schools about private school issues.

Find Bills of Interest in the California legislature
You may also subscribe to a bill to watch its progress.

"In re Rachel L." decision - 3/5/08
The "In re Rachel L." decision handed down by the Court of Appeal of the State of California, Second Appellate District, in Los Angeles County, on Febuary 28, 2008, has become too controversial to ignore.

Official California Legislative Information
This WWW site is maintained by the Legislative Counsel of California, pursuant to California law.

Politics of Education
Prop 38--The Debate on Vouchers. Links to the public debate on vouchers. At CHN's members meeting on Aug 5th in San Jose, CHN's Board of Trustees voted against making a policy statement about Prop 38.
